This PR adds a read-through cache in front of the Maplight tile renderer. Security-relevant points: cache keys include the tenant scope hash, entries are never shared across tenants, and eviction is size-based with a hard TTL so stale permission changes age out. All constants are centralized in one module to simplify audit. The values under review are:

limits module of tafof-kagef:
RATE_LIMITS = {
    "zorix": 10,
    "ralath": 1,
    "quenwyn": 2,
    "holael": 10,
}

To the release manager: I'm passing ownership of the Pellwick deep-link router to Sorrel before the 4.2 cut. The intent-matching table now lives in the Farrowgate config service; stale entries were purged last sprint. Watch the fallback route — it silently swallows malformed slugs, which inflated our drop-off metrics in March. The staging resolver needs its keystore unlocked before each regression pass, and that keystore accepts only one credential. For the signing vault, the recovery phrase is noted directly below.

recovery phrase for tafog-fafog: novix-novdor-fraath-brieth-olieth-oliix-rusix-wenion-julax-druox

Handover note — Crumbwheel order cutoffs.

Welcome aboard. The bakery cutoff rule in Crumbwheel closes same-day orders at 14:00 local to each storefront, not UTC — this has bitten us twice. Holiday overrides live in the calendar service and take precedence silently, so always check there first when a cutoff looks wrong. To unlock the calendar service's admin console after a restart, enter the recovery passphrase below.

vault phrase of bagap-bahaf = silion-pelox-sorox-casdor-quenwyn-fraax-eliox-praael-kelion-quenvan-kasox-rusael-norius-belvan

**Ticket: Config drift on quietowl-dedup (staging vs prod)**

Hey on-call — heads up, the alert deduplicator (quietowl-dedup) is behaving differently in prod than staging. Dedup windows look longer in prod, so pages are getting swallowed that staging would've fired. Pretty sure someone hand-edited prod after the Falkner incident and never backported it. Don't redeploy until we reconcile, or we'll clobber whatever hotfix is live. For reference, here's the current prod configuration as pulled from the running instance.

config for yajep-tafof:
[rusath]
team = julmir
access_code = ac_fe37fd
host = rusath.novactech.test
port = 8000
owner = pelmir.weneth
peer = oliwyn.olvarqdyn.internal